🎬 The Premise

Released in 2019, Mercy enters the Drama genre with a narrative focused on The quiet life of the small town Piedade's inhabitants is shaken up by the arrival of a big oil company, which barges in taking over houses and local businesses, throwing everyone out, to better reach and use the area's natural resources. Under the direction of Cláudio Assis, the film attempts to weave detailed character arcs with visual storytelling.

Synopsis

The quiet life of the small town Piedade's inhabitants is shaken up by the arrival of a big oil company, which barges in taking over houses and local businesses, throwing everyone out, to better reach and use the area's natural resources.
